Transaction 78a8693755660878aa3ea33e3bd070dc4124f8ec75c56e9770d28d28aa7e9abe
1 Input
1 Output
-
78a8693755660878aa3ea33e3bd070dc4124f8ec75c56e9770d28d28aa7e9abe:0
- value
- 66910
- script pubkey
- OP_0 OP_PUSHBYTES_20 db64b394ec4bee5bd24240cf0b2f410424973155
- address
- bc1qmdjt898vf0h9h5jzgr8skt6pqsjfwv24t742q5